Aspen Alumni Dialogue in Barcelona
On December 9, the Aspen Institute España hosted its first Aspe Alumni Dialogue in Barcelona, with the support of the Barcelona City Council. This gathering brought together alumni from all Aspen Institute España programs at the historic Saló de Cròniques of the Barcelona City Hall.
The event started with a guided tour of City Hall at 5:30 p.m. for interested attendees. Formal proceedings started at 6:30 p.m. with welcome remarks by Laia Claverol, Local Manager of Barcelona City Hall followed by a brief dialogue between José M. de Areilza, Secretary General of Aspen Institute España, Jaume Duch, Minister for the European Union and External Action of the Generalitat de Catalunya and Pablo García-Berdoy, Ambassador of Spain and European Public Affairs Leader at LLYC.
After the discussion, guests were invited to enjoy a Spanish wine reception to conclude the evening.
